网络监控程序如何实现智能决策支持?
在当今信息爆炸的时代,网络监控程序在维护网络安全、预防网络犯罪、保障个人信息安全等方面发挥着至关重要的作用。然而,如何让网络监控程序实现智能决策支持,成为了一个亟待解决的问题。本文将深入探讨网络监控程序如何实现智能决策支持,以期为相关领域的研究和实践提供参考。
一、网络监控程序概述
网络监控程序是一种实时监控网络运行状态、安全状况、用户行为等信息的软件。其主要功能包括:
实时监控:对网络流量、设备状态、用户行为等进行实时监控,及时发现异常情况。
安全防护:识别并拦截恶意攻击、病毒、木马等安全威胁,保障网络安全。
数据分析:对监控数据进行分析,为决策提供依据。
报警通知:在发现异常情况时,及时向管理员发送报警通知。
二、网络监控程序实现智能决策支持的途径
- 数据挖掘与机器学习
数据挖掘:通过对大量网络监控数据的挖掘,提取有价值的信息,为智能决策提供支持。例如,通过分析用户行为数据,识别潜在的安全风险。
机器学习:利用机器学习算法,对网络监控数据进行训练,使其具备自动识别、分类、预测等功能。例如,通过训练模型,实现自动识别恶意流量。
- 深度学习
深度学习是一种模拟人脑神经网络结构的学习方法,具有强大的特征提取和分类能力。在网络监控领域,深度学习可以应用于以下方面:
- 图像识别:对网络监控画面进行实时分析,识别异常行为或设备故障。
- 语音识别:对网络通信进行实时分析,识别异常语音信号。
- 知识图谱
知识图谱是一种将实体、关系和属性进行关联的图结构数据。在网络监控领域,知识图谱可以应用于以下方面:
- 关联分析:通过分析实体之间的关系,发现潜在的安全风险。
- 推理预测:根据已知信息,预测可能发生的安全事件。
- 大数据技术
大数据技术可以实现对海量网络监控数据的存储、处理和分析。在网络监控领域,大数据技术可以应用于以下方面:
- 实时处理:对实时数据进行分析,及时发现异常情况。
- 历史数据分析:对历史数据进行分析,总结安全规律。
三、案例分析
以某企业网络监控程序为例,该程序采用数据挖掘、机器学习和深度学习等技术,实现了以下功能:
实时监控:对网络流量、设备状态、用户行为等进行实时监控,及时发现异常情况。
安全防护:通过识别恶意流量,拦截病毒、木马等安全威胁。
数据分析:对监控数据进行分析,为决策提供依据。
报警通知:在发现异常情况时,及时向管理员发送报警通知。
通过以上功能,该企业网络监控程序成功保障了企业网络安全,降低了安全风险。
四、总结
网络监控程序实现智能决策支持,是网络安全领域的重要研究方向。通过数据挖掘、机器学习、深度学习、知识图谱和大数据技术等手段,网络监控程序可以实现实时监控、安全防护、数据分析和报警通知等功能,为网络安全保障提供有力支持。随着技术的不断发展,网络监控程序将更加智能化,为网络安全领域带来更多可能性。
猜你喜欢:分布式追踪